Finance Consultant - Valuation and M&A Finance Service (f/m/x)

Raiffeisen Bank International AG

  • Österreich, Wien
  • Full-time
  • Home office possible
  • Remote

Tasks

  • Act as central point of contact for all financial matters in transactions and strategic initiatives, including identifying key opportunities and risks with a view to long-term value creation, conducting materiality analyses, and developing management recommendations
  • Manage internal projects including creation of financial models as well as value driver and benchmarking analyses to support strategic and impact analysis as well as perform valuations
  • Perform detailed financial analysis, including financials, business projections and cash flow modeling to conduct valuations and impact analysis
  • Conduct market, competition, and business analyses
  • Manage financial due diligence processes, including gathering and analyzing data, and identifying key risks and opportunities
  • Manage the impairment testing process of the overall participation portfolio
  • Have an intrapreneurial mindset and build strong relationships with internal stakeholders to support seamless process, project, and deal execution. Work collaboratively with other team members on national and international M&A projects
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ory and reporting standards throughout the transaction and participation valuation processes
